What exactly is Modified Bitumen?

Essentially modified bitumen is base and cap sheets that can be hot asphalt applied, torch applied, or cold process applied (mop down). Your base sheet is usually determined by the type of cap sheet you choose, and just like shingles there are several different types of cap sheets to choose from. Examples below. Typical Uses
There are other products on the market for these uses, but Ruberoid® Torch Membrane is among the thickest at 0.148″, making is harder to fully puncture than most alternative products.
- Decks – Modified is a great choice under floating decks.
- Crickets and Dead Valleys
- Flat Roof Systems
- Low Sloped Roofs – If your roof doesn’t have enough pitch for shingles then modified would be a good option, particularly Granulated due to its finished look in a variety of colors.

Benefits – Torch Plus Granule FR
- Available Guarantees: System guarantees are available for up to 20 years
- No Coating Required: For Class A roofing fire rating from UL and FMRC
- Cost Effective: The installed cost of RUBEROID® TORCH PLUS GRANULE FR Membrane is less than most single-ply systems on the market today
- Lightweight: Installed premium roof designs weigh less than 3 pounds per square foot
- Resilient: RUBEROID® TORCH PLUS GRANULE FR Membrane’s heavyweight polyester mat core allows it to resist splits and tears due to its pliability and elongation characteristics
- Durable: Specially formulated modified asphalt gives RUBEROID® TORCH PLUS GRANULE FR Membrane lasting performance
- Wind Uplift Resistance: Selected roofing assemblies with RUBEROID® TORCH PLUS GRANULE FR Membrane meets FMRC Class 1-180 when installed over concrete decks
